Place the watermelon with the yellow spot, if any, on the bottom and out of view. Be sure it is in a stable position so it will not roll.
Measure the diameter of the watermelon.
Find the center and add 1/2 inch.
Using a non-toxic marker, mark a line horizontally around the watermelon so you can slice off the top evenly.
Before cutting, you will need to trace the handle. See next step.
